Outcomes Assessment at Carteret Community College How did we get Here and Where are We?
Some background • Associate, Diploma, and Certificate programs: 34 • Curriculum Enrollment: 1,600 • Online Courses Offered: 78 (F/H) • Full-time Faculty: 68 • Part-time Faculty: 95 • Staff/Administration: 108
A little more background • Reliance on anecdotal data • Lack of purposeful, systematic, institution-wide assessment process • DL expanding rapidly • No concerted advising program • Retention rate: ~50% • Annual graduation rate: ~16% • SACS on the horizon
Proposed Solution • Assessment • Distance Learning • Advisement Title III
Goals and Objectives Goal 1 Improve assessment of student learning and institutional effectiveness
Goals and Objectives Goal 2 Improve student retention through increased focus on instructional technologyand methodology
Goals and Objectives Goal 3 Improve student retention through increased focus on advising
Assessment Outputs and Outcomes • The Dialogue - from the top down…and the bottom up • Professional Development (workshops, workshops, & more workshops) • Institutional Level Learning Outcomes • Program Level Learning Outcomes • Program & Unit Reviews • Closing the loop • An ongoing quest for Quality
Establishing a common language - • Outputs vs. Outcomes • Institutional Level Learning Outcomes • Program Outcomes • Administrative Outcomes • Program Level Learning Outcomes • Program Review • Administrative Unit Review
Key Dates • 2006 • October: Title III award received ~ • 2007 • January: Firstoutcomes assessment workshops~ ~ • February: Institutional Level Learning Outcomes identified ~ • April: Revision of Program Review process begins ~ • June: Intensive, week-long Outcomes boot camp ~
Key Dates • 2007 • July: Begin working with administrative units on Outcomes Assessment ~ • July:Phase I (Program Review ) programs & working teams identified ~ • August: Phase I training held ~ • August: Administrative Review process revised; trainings held ~
Key Dates • 2007 • September: Program Level Learning Outcomes& Administrative Unit Outcomes workshops held ~ • September:Survey writing workshops held ~ • September:Focus on assessing Distance Learning (select online & seated courses; peer review process, quality assessment) ~
Key Dates • 2007 • November - December: Reading/scoring ILLOs~ • 2008 • January - March: Working with programs/units on data collection • April-June: Collecting data / Use of results
Assessment Outputs • January 2007 • 6 workshops • 54 FT faculty • 18 PT faculty • 20 staff • September 2007 • 4 overview workshops • 12 Admin Outcomes workshops • 8 follow-up workshops • 4 Instructional Outcomes workshops • 36 FT faculty • 63 staff • June 2007 • 4 days of workshops • One-on-one with Phase I teams • ILLO workshop • 44 FT faculty September 2007 Survey Writing Workshops (2) 16 Faculty / 12 Staff

Assessment Outcomes Program Review Process • May 2008 - 8 programs complete the process • June 2008 - presentations to the Curriculum Committee • June/July 2008 - debriefing sessions held (use of results!) • August 2008 - Phase II programs begin the process

Learnings Communication: getting people to understand - getting people to show up; advancewarning is key Developing a system - creating consistency in forms & documents Assessments: shoot for what’s available Workload - tapping the unusual suspects Being inclusive - developing relationships & rapport across campus Convincing people that “it’s not just SACS”
